摘要:区块链摇号是一种基于区块链技术实现的摇号方式,可以有效保障摇号公正和可追溯性。但由于技术不断演进,区块链摇号也存在被作弊的可能性。本文将从区块链摇号的基本原理、应用场景、作弊风险和防范措施四个方面进行详细阐述,以便读者更好地了解区块链摇号。
1、区块链摇号基本原理
区块链摇号是基于区块链技术和密码学原理实现的一种摇号方式。其基本原理是将候选人的信息通过算法进行加密,并将加密后的信息存储在区块链上,候选人通过验证身份和符合条件后,可以获取私钥进行解密。而摇号结果也是通过算法在区块链上生成的随机数,保证结果的随机性和公正性。通过这种方式,实现了摇号过程公开透明,不可篡改,具有可追溯性等特点。
区块链摇号技术的应用场景主要集中在政府部门和大型企业,如摇号选房、选号牌等领域,可以有效减少舞弊和黑幕,提高人们对公共事务的信心。
然而,随着技术的不断发展,区块链摇号也不可避免地存在一些作弊的风险,如物理攻击和算法漏洞等,需要采取一系列防范措施来保证公正性。
2、区块链摇号的应用场景
区块链摇号技术主要应用在政府和企业领域,如摇号选房、选号牌、选举等场景。在这些场合,区块链技术可以有效保障选举的公正和可追溯性,避免黑幕和内部人员作弊。同时,区块链摇号还可以应用在在线抽奖、足彩等活动中,可以有效防止网络攻击和黑箱操作,保障用户利益。
对于政府来说,采用区块链摇号可以有效提升政府公信力和形象,减少舞弊案件发生,减轻政府的司法负担。对于企业来说,采用区块链摇号可以提高企业信任度和品牌影响力,吸引更多顾客和投资者。因此,区块链摇号技术在进行公正抽奖和选举方面,具有广阔的应用前景。
3、区块链摇号的作弊风险
区块链摇号作弊的风险主要体现在以下两个方面:
第一,物理攻击风险。由于区块链摇号是依靠硬件来存储信息,因此一旦黑客攻击了这些设备,就有可能破坏随机数生成的过程,并对摇号过程造成极大的干扰。例如,黑客可以在随机数生成的过程中,通过针对存储设备的物理攻击,破坏某些位数,从而掌控随机数的生成。
第二,算法漏洞风险。区块链摇号依赖于算法生成随机数,如果算法存在漏洞或者候选人的信息被解密,则会影响摇号的公正性。例如,黑客可以通过提前获取随机数的算法或算法的源代码,或者获取候选人的信息从而预测随机数,从而获得更多的利益。
4、预防及解决方案
为了预防和解决区块链摇号的作弊风险,我们可以采取以下一些方案:
一是盲签名方案。在盲签名方案中,摇号系统不能获得候选人的信息。这种方案可防止信息泄露和篡改,提高了安全性和匿名性。
二是多方签名方案。多方签名方案意味着,在签名过程中,需要有两个或多个管理员参与签名。对于恶意管理员而言,他们需要同时攻破多个管理员才能操纵摇号程序,这种方案极大地提高了作弊门槛。
三是使用高安全性的算法。为了避免算法漏洞的风险,我们可以采用比特币挖掘所使用的SHA256算法,该算法具有高强度、不可预测性和不可反向解密性,能够有效保障区块链摇号的不可篡改性和随机性。
四是加强物理安全措施。我们可以采用军用芝麻锁等高安全性和抗攻击性的硬件来存储和保护随机数和私钥,这样可以有效防止物理攻击的发生。
总结:
区块链摇号技术是一种新兴的技术,可以为政府和企业提供公正、公开、透明的选举场景,防止黑幕和作弊。虽然区块链摇号也存在被攻击和作弊的风险,但通过盲签名、多方签名、使用高安全性算法和加强物理安全措施等,可以更加有效地保护摇号的公正性和可追溯性。
本文由捡漏网https://www.jianlow.com整理,帮助您快速了解相关知识,获取最新最全的资讯。